Hey, I’m Yashodhar

Experienced Full Stack Developer and Final Year Computer Engineering Student from Mumbai, India 🇮🇳. Passionate about crafting efficient, innovative web solutions.

Work Experience

  1. Software Developer

    Drona Pay

    • Refactored and optimized a React codebase, reducing load times by 30%.
    • Implemented best practices to improve code quality, reducing maintenance effort by 20%.
    • Contributed to the development of Finos Perspective Dashboards, leveraging React to deliver data-driven visualizations.
    • Resolved 100+ bugs and issues to maintain dashboard stability.
  2. Maintainer

    TCET Open Source

    • Revamped the college website, resulting in significant improvement in user engagement and accessibility for diverse user base of 4000 students.
    • Enhanced UX with an intuitive design, reducing navigation time by 30%.
    • Leveraged React and Tailwind CSS to contribute to the Resume Screener Project.
  3. React Development Intern

    Drona Pay

    • Collaborated with design and product teams to align userinterface with design guidelines, resulting in a 20% increase in user satisfaction.
    • Developed and implemented behavioural fingerprints and keystroke dynamics, enhancing security by 15%.
    • Created a comprehensive Postman automation suite, reducing testing time by 30% and enhancing efficiency in API functionality validation during development cycles.

Projects

Authease

Authease

Simplifying Authentication, Amplifying Development
Authease, currently in development, is an ambitious Node.js library that simplifies user authentication for frontend applications. It offers modular components, centralized configuration, and seamless integration with various frameworks, allowing developers to implement secure authentication features without extensive backend setup. Know More
  • Node.js
  • Express.js
  • Typescript
  • Next.js
  • Tailwind CSS
  • MongoDB
  • Redis
  • Rollup
Lingoleap

Lingoleap

Elevate Your Language Journey
Lingo Leap is a web application offering interactive Hindi language therapy materials and learning exercises. It features structured Hindi content across beginner to advanced levels, gamified progression through XP and streaks, and supervisor oversight, providing an engaging platform for Hindi language therapy and learning. Know More
  • Node.js
  • Express.js
  • Next.js
  • Tailwind CSS
  • MongoDB
Codingpeer

Codingpeer

Connecting Coders, Inspiring Innovation
Codingpeer is a web application designed to connect developers and tech enthusiasts globally. Built with React.js and Firebase, it facilitates project collaboration, partner searching, and networking opportunities. Future plans include real-time chat, video conversations, and group creation features. Know More
  • React
  • Firebase
  • Bootstrap
  • SASS
Medishare

Medishare

Bridging the Gap in Healthcare
Medishare is a community pharmacy application that collects and distributes unused medicines to the needy. It features a medicine bank, volunteer management, and consumer protection measures, aiming to reduce drug wastage and improve medication access for underprivileged communities. Know More
  • React
  • Firebase
  • Bootstrap
  • SASS

Skills

Programming Languages

  • Javascript
  • Typescript
  • Java
  • C++

Technical

  • React
  • Next.js
  • Node.js
  • Express.js
  • MongoDB
  • Redis
  • Firebase
  • Astro
  • Tailwind CSS
  • SASS

Tools

  • Git
  • Postman
  • Docker
  • build-tools/rollup Created with Sketch. Rollup
  • GitHub
  • Gitlab
  • Vercel
  • macOS

Currently Learning

  • file_type_solidity Solidity
  • Blockchain
  • Solana
  • Devops
  • Kubernetes
  • WebRTC

About Me

My name is Yashodhar Patel, and my journey into programming began with a simple curiosity that has since grown into a deep passion. Currently, I’m pursuing a Bachelor’s in Computer Science Engineering with a CGPA of 9.35 at the University of Mumbai.

I’ve gained valuable industry experience as a Software Developer at Drona Pay, where I worked on real-time fraud protection systems. Additionally, I’ve contributed as a Maintainer at TCET Open Source. I’m also an active participant in hackathons and coding competitions, always looking for new ways to challenge myself and grow.

One of my ongoing projects is developing AuthEase, a Node.js SDK designed to simplify authentication for developers. I’ve solved over 250+ Data Structure and Algorithm problems, which fuels my commitment to continuous learning and making a meaningful impact in the tech industry.

Yashodhar Patel